- 1. Radiator fins plugged w/ debris, chaff, seeds, etc - hard to clean out in the field
2. Thermostat stuck closed
3. Vicous clutch on fan not engaging
4. Oil cooler radiator leak (oil will be in the water and the cooling system overpressurized.)
5. Water pump. Even if seems to be running smooth, the impeller is plastic garbage and can be broken. Heats up under load and then cools when not loaded.
